    SoftParticles, based on his code: http://www.joeforte.net/projects/soft-particles/
    Requires using float texture (I didnt make a check if it is unavailable, but has to do).

    I made SoftParticlesProcessor and adding it to the viewport and using “Shaders/SoftParticle.j3md” instead of “Common/MatDefs/Misc/Particle.j3md”
    will render them differently.
